• PHP字符串函数总结


    字符串函数

      1 addcslashes — 为字符串里面的部分字符添加反斜线转义字符
      2 
      3 addslashes — 用指定的方式对字符串里面的字符进行转义
      4 
      5 bin2hex — 将二进制数据转换成十六进制表示
      6 
      7 choprtrim() 的别名函数
      8 
      9 chr — 返回一个字符的ASCII码
     10 
     11 chunk_split — 按一定的字符长度将字符串分割成小块
     12 
     13 convert_cyr_string — 将斯拉夫语字符转换为别的字符
     14 
     15 convert_uudecode — 解密一个字符串
     16 
     17 convert_uuencode — 加密一个字符串
     18 
     19 count_chars — 返回一个字符串里面的字符使用信息
     20 
     21 crc32 — 计算一个字符串的crc32多项式
     22 
     23 crypt — 单向散列加密函数
     24 
     25 echo — 用以显示一些内容
     26 
     27 explode — 将一个字符串用分割符转变为一数组形式
     28 
     29 fprintf — 按照要求对数据进行返回,并直接写入文档流
     30 
     31 get_html_translation_table — 返回可以转换的HTML实体
     32 
     33 hebrev — 将Hebrew编码的字符串转换为可视的文本
     34 
     35 hebrevc — 将Hebrew编码的字符串转换为可视的文本
     36 
     37 html_entity_decodehtmlentities ()函数的反函数,将HTML实体转换为字符
     38 
     39 htmlentities — 将字符串中一些字符转换为HTML实体
     40 
     41 htmlspecialchars_decode —htmlspecialchars()函数的反函数,将HTML实体转换为字符
     42 
     43 htmlspecialchars — 将字符串中一些字符转换为HTML实体
     44 
     45 implode — 将数组用特定的分割符转变为字符串
     46 
     47 join — 将数组转变为字符串,implode()函数的别名
     48 
     49 levenshtein — 计算两个词的差别大小
     50 
     51 localeconv — 获取数字相关的格式定义
     52 
     53 ltrim — 去除字符串左侧的空白或者指定的字符
     54 
     55 md5_file — 将一个文件进行MD5算法加密
     56 
     57 md5 — 将一个字符串进行MD5算法加密
     58 
     59 metaphone — 判断一个字符串的发音规则
     60 
     61 money_format — 按照参数对数字进行格式化的输出
     62 
     63 nl_langinfo — 查询语言和本地信息
     64 
     65 nl2br — 将字符串中的换行符“
    ”替换成“<br/> 66 
     67 number_format — 按照参数对数字进行格式化的输出
     68 
     69 ord — 将一个ASCII码转换为一个字符
     70 
     71 parse_str — 把一定格式的字符串转变为变量和值
     72 
     73 print — 用以输出一个单独的值
     74 
     75 printf — 按照要求对数据进行显示
     76 
     77 quoted_printable_decode — 将一个字符串加密为一个8位的二进制字符串
     78 
     79 quotemeta — 对若干个特定字符进行转义
     80 
     81 rtrim — 去除字符串右侧的空白或者指定的字符
     82 
     83 setlocale — 设置关于数字,日期等等的本地格式
     84 
     85 sha1_file — 将一个文件进行SHA1算法加密
     86 
     87 sha1 — 将一个字符串进行SHA1算法加密
     88 
     89 similar_text — 比较两个字符串,返回系统认为的相似字符个数
     90 
     91 soundex — 判断一个字符串的发音规则
     92 
     93 sprintf — 按照要求对数据进行返回,但是不输出
     94 
     95 sscanf — 可以对字符串进行格式化
     96 
     97 str_ireplace — 像str_replace()函数一样匹配和替换字符串,但是不区分大小写
     98 
     99 str_pad — 对字符串进行两侧的补白
    100 
    101 str_repeat — 对字符串进行重复组合
    102 
    103 str_replace — 匹配和替换字符串
    104 
    105 str_rot13 — 将字符串进行ROT13加密处理
    106 
    107 str_shuffle — 对一个字符串里面的字符进行随机排序
    108 
    109 str_split — 将一个字符串按照字符间距分割为一个数组
    110 
    111 str_word_count — 获取字符串里面的英文单词信息
    112 
    113 strcasecmp — 对字符串进行大小比较,不区分大小写
    114 
    115 strchr — 通过比较返回一个字符串的部分strstr()函数的别名
    116 
    117 strcmp — 对字符串进行大小比较
    118 
    119 strcoll – 根据本地设置对字符串进行大小比较
    120 
    121 strcspn — 返回字符连续非匹配长度的值
    122 
    123 strip_tags — 去除一个字符串里面的HTML和PHP代码
    124 
    125 stripcslashes — 反转义addcslashes()函数转义处理过的字符串
    126 
    127 stripos — 查找并返回首个匹配项的位置,匹配不区分大小写
    128 
    129 stripslashes — 反转义addslashes()函数转义处理过的字符串
    130 
    131 stristr — 通过比较返回一个字符串的部分,比较时不区分大小写
    132 
    133 strlen — 获取一个字符串的编码长度
    134 
    135 strnatcasecmp — 使用自然排序法对字符串进行大小比较,不区分大小写
    136 
    137 strnatcmp — 使用自然排序法对字符串进行大小比较
    138 
    139 strncasecmp — 对字符串的前N个字符进行大小比较,不区分大小写
    140 
    141 strncmp — 对字符串的前N个字符进行大小比较
    142 
    143 strpbrk — 通过比较返回一个字符串的部分
    144 
    145 strpos — 查找并返回首个匹配项的位置
    146 
    147 strrchr — 通过从后往前比较返回一个字符串的部分
    148 
    149 strrev — 将字符串里面的所有字母反向排列
    150 
    151 strripos — 从后往前查找并返回首个匹配项的位置,匹配不区分大小写
    152 
    153 strrpos – 从后往前查找并返回首个匹配项的位置
    154 
    155 strspn — 匹配并返回字符连续出现长度的值
    156 
    157 strstr — 通过比较返回一个字符串的部分
    158 
    159 strtok — 用指定的若干个字符来分割字符串
    160 
    161 strtolower — 将字符串转变为小写
    162 
    163 strtoupper –将字符串转变为大写
    164 
    165 strtr — 对字符串比较替换
    166 
    167 substr_compare — 对字符串进行截取后的比较
    168 
    169 substr_count — 计算字符串中某字符段的出现次数
    170 
    171 substr_replace — 对字符串中的部分字符进行替换
    172 
    173 substr — 对字符串进行截取
    174 
    175 trim — 去除字符串两边的空白或者指定的字符
    176 
    177 ucfirst — 将所给字符串的第一个字母转换为大写
    178 
    179 ucwords — 将所给字符串的每一个英文单词的第一个字母变成大写
    180 
    181 vfprintf — 按照要求对数据进行返回,并直接写入文档流
    182 
    183 vprintf — 按照要求对数据进行显示
    184 
    185 vsprintf — 按照要求对数据进行返回,但是不输出
    186 
    187 wordwrap — 按照一定的字符长度分割字符串
  • 相关阅读:
    Ionic
    图片破碎 效果 修正
    去掉浏览器右侧动滚条宽度对页面的影响
    ng 依赖注入
    ng 通过factory方法来创建一个心跳服务
    ng 自定义服务
    ng $http 和远程服务器通信的一个服务。
    ng $interval(周期性定时器) $timeout(延迟定时器)
    ng $scope与$rootScope的关系
    函数重载
  • 原文地址:https://www.cnblogs.com/Jessie-candy/p/12971500.html
Copyright © 2020-2023  润新知